Comprehending the IELTS Test
The IELTS test is designed to evaluate the language abilities of candidates in four locations: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. There are 2 versions of the test: Academic and General Training. The Academic variation is ideal for those who wish to study at a college level or look for professional registration, while the General Training version is for those who are migrating to an English-speaking nation or seeking work experience.

Preparing for the IELTS Test
Listening
- Practice Listening: Listen to a variety of English audio products, such as podcasts, news broadcasts, and lectures.
- Take Practice Tests: Use main IELTS practice tests to imitate the test environment.
- Note-Taking: Develop your note-taking skills to catch key details rapidly.
Checking out
- Check out Widely: Read a series of texts, including academic posts, newspapers, and books.
- Time Management: Practice reading and answering questions within the time limitation.
- Understanding: Focus on understanding the main points and supporting information.
Writing
- Job 1 (Academic): Practice composing reports based upon graphs, charts, and diagrams.
- Task 1 (General Training): Practice writing letters for various functions.
- Task 2: Practice writing essays on numerous topics.
- Feedback: Seek feedback from instructors or peers to improve your writing.
Speaking
- Practice Speaking: Engage in conversations with native English speakers or use language exchange platforms.
- Mock Interviews: Participate in mock IELTS speaking tests to build self-confidence.
- Pronunciation and Fluency: Focus on improving your pronunciation and speaking fluently.
